এমএসএমকিউ বার্তা পেতে খুব ধীর


8

আমরা একটি দুর্দান্ত বৃহত এমএসএমকিউ এনভায়রনমেন্ট সেটআপ পেয়েছি যা আজ একটি স্থবির স্থানে গ্রাইন্ড করার সিদ্ধান্ত নিয়েছে।

(সবকিছুই vSphere 4.0 আপডেট 1 এর অধীনে একটি ভিএম)

8 টি ওয়েব সার্ভার রয়েছে যা নেটে ক্লায়েন্টদের কাছ থেকে ডেটা গ্রহণ করে। এই মেশিনগুলিতে সমস্ত এমএসএমকিউ ইনস্টল করা আছে এবং কেবল এমএসএমকিউ বার্তাটি মূল এমএসএমকিউ সার্ভারে প্রেরণ করে। বার্তাগুলি বর্তমানে বহির্মুখী সারিতে পাইল করা আছে। এই মেশিনগুলি 2 জিগ র‌্যাম এবং 2 টি ভিসিপিইউ সহ উইন্ডোজ 2008 ওয়েব সংস্করণ।

আমাদের কাছে একটি ক্লাস্টার্ড এমএসএমকিউ সার্ভার (উইন্ডোজ ক্লাস্টার সার্ভার) রয়েছে যা 8 টি ওয়েব সার্ভারের বার্তা পায়। সারিতে থাকা তথ্যের পরিমাণের কোনও সীমা নেই। হার্ড ড্রাইভটি 50 জিগস এবং 46 গিগস মুক্ত স্থান রয়েছে। এই মেশিনগুলি 8 জিগ র‌্যাম এবং 4 টি ভিসিপিইউ সহ উইন্ডোজ 2008 এন্টারপ্রাইজ সংস্করণ। ক্লাস্টারে 2 টি ভিসিপিইউ থাকত তবে সিপিইউ লোড 100% হিট করছিল, তাই আমি উইন্ডোজ ক্লাস্টারের উভয় নোডকে 4 টি ভিসিপিইউতে বাড়িয়েছি।

4 টি অ্যাপ সার্ভার রয়েছে যা সারিগুলি থেকে বার্তাগুলি পড়ে এবং তাদের প্রক্রিয়া করে।

সাধারণত এটি সবই নিখুঁতভাবে কাজ করে তবে আজকের দিনে নয়।

আজ সকালে সবকিছু খুব ধীরে চলছে। 8 টি ওয়েব সার্ভার বর্তমানে বহির্মুখী সারিতে বসে 300k বার্তা প্রদর্শন করছে। ক্লাস্টার্ড সার্ভারটি বর্তমানে সারিগুলিতে এক মিলিয়নের বেশি বার্তাগুলি দেখায় (কিছুগুলি 200k এর চেয়ে কম)।

যদি আমি 8 টি ওয়েব সার্ভারগুলিতে পারফোনকে দেখি তবে এটি দেখায় যে আমি প্রতি সেকেন্ডে 2 বার্তা প্রেরণ করেছি। আমি যদি ক্লাস্টারে পারফোন দেখি তবে এটি প্রতি সেকেন্ডে ~ 7 টি বার্তা ক্লাস্টারে আসছে shows

যে মেশিনগুলি পড়ছে তারা প্রতিটি বার্তা পাচ্ছে না। দ্রুততম পরিষেবাগুলি প্রতি সেকেন্ডে 10-12 বার্তা পাচ্ছে, ধীরে ধীরে 0 বা 1 দেখাচ্ছে।

সম্প্রতি কেবলমাত্র পরিবর্তনগুলি হ'ল আমরা ফ্রন্ট এন্ড ওয়েব সার্ভারের সংখ্যা 4 থেকে 8 এ পরিবর্তন করেছি 8. আমরা প্রায় 2 সপ্তাহ আগে ইস্যু ছাড়াই এটি করেছি। মঙ্গলবার আমরা তাদের চালিত করেছিলাম যাতে বাকি 4 টি কীভাবে বোঝা পরিচালনা করতে পারে। বুধবার আমরা চারটি আরও নতুন মেশিন চালু করেছিলাম।

ক্লাস্টারের ডিস্কটি খুব কম আইও দেখায় এবং কোনও সারি নেই।

নিরাপদ থাকতে আমি পাওয়ারপথকে নতুন সংস্করণে আপডেট করেছি তবে এটি কোনওরকম সাহায্য করেনি।

8 টি ওয়েব সার্ভারগুলি একটি ভিএলএএন-তে রয়েছে এবং ক্লাস্টার'ড সার্ভার এবং অ্যাপ্লিকেশন সার্ভারগুলি দ্বিতীয় ভিএলএএন-তে রয়েছে। ভিএলএএনগুলির মধ্যে কোনও ফায়ারওয়াল নেই।

এবং কোনও মেশিনে অ্যাপ্লিকেশন বা সিস্টেম লগের জন্য দরকারী কিছু নেই।


2
দেখা যাচ্ছে যে ধীর এমএসএমকিউ পড়ার কারণটি আসলে একটি অ্যাপ্লিকেশন সমস্যা ছিল। পরিষেবাগুলি যা সারিবদ্ধ থেকে পড়েছে তারপরে ফাইল ভাগ করে নেবে। ফাইল ভাগটি দীর্ঘ এবং দীর্ঘ সময় নেওয়া শুরু করেছে, যার ফলে পরিষেবাগুলি ধীর হয়ে গেছে, যার ফলে সারিগুলি ব্যাক আপ হয়ে গেছে এবং এখন আমাদের মধ্যে গোলযোগ রয়েছে। স্পষ্টতই আমাদের ব্যবহারকারীর বেসটি পরিকল্পনার চেয়ে অনেক দ্রুত বৃদ্ধি পেয়েছে এবং আমরা স্যানের মধ্যে একটি RAID গোষ্ঠী তৈরি করি যা ফাইলের ভাগগুলি হোস্ট করে। সোমবার আমরা আমাদের বিক্রেতার সাথে আরও সান স্পেসের জন্য রাশ অর্ডার করব।
mrdenny

2
আমরা এই সারি বৃদ্ধি সময়ের আগে দেখতে পাইনি কারণ আমাদের মনিটরিং সার্ভারটি একটি উইন্ডোজ 2003 সার্ভার, এবং উইন্ডোজ 2003 মেশিনের ক্লাস্টারযুক্ত উইন্ডোজ 2008 এমএসএমকিউ ক্যুগুলি দূরবর্তীভাবে পর্যবেক্ষণ করতে পারে না। পর্যবেক্ষণ সার্ভার ইতিমধ্যে মার্চ একটি আপগ্রেড জন্য নির্ধারিত। <sigh>
mrdenny

উত্তর:


4

যখনই কেউ বলে যে তাদের দশ লক্ষেরও বেশি বার্তা রয়েছে অ্যালার্ম ক্লাক্সনগুলি বন্ধ হয়ে যায়! বার্তাগুলি পরিচালনা করার জন্য কার্নেল (পেজযুক্ত পুল) মেমরির প্রয়োজন। আপনার কাছে যদি এমন বিশাল সংখ্যক বার্তা থাকে তবে ক্লাস্টার্ড সার্ভারে যা পাওয়া যায় তা আপনি ক্লান্ত করছেন। একটি সারিতে বার্তাগুলির সংখ্যার জন্য একটি অনুকূল সংখ্যা শূন্য - মূলত নিশ্চিত করুন যে আপনি বার্তাগুলি পৌঁছানোর চেয়ে দ্রুত প্রসেস করতে পারবেন।

আমি ওয়েব সার্ভারগুলি বন্ধ করে দেওয়া এবং বার্তাগুলি পুনরায় অনলাইনে ফিরিয়ে আনার আগে সম্পূর্ণরূপে প্রক্রিয়াজাতকরণের সুপারিশ করব।

এই ব্লগ পোস্টের আইটেম 4 রেফারেন্স: http://blogs.msdn.com/johnbreakwell/archive/2006/09/18/insuu-- উত্স- run-away-run-away.aspx

চিয়ার্স জন ব্রেকওয়েল (এমএসএফটি)


আমি এই মুহুর্তে পিএসএস-এ একটি কল পেয়েছি এবং আমি এখনই তাদের কাছে ফিরে আসার জন্য অপেক্ষা করছি। আমি ওয়েব সার্ভারগুলিতে কিউগুলিতে প্রবাহিত হওয়া থেকে বার্তাগুলি থামিয়েছি। ওয়েব সার্ভারগুলিতে আউটবাউন্ড সারিগুলি প্রতিটি এই মুহুর্তে 1 গিগের তথ্য দিয়ে পূর্ণ। ক্লাস্টারযুক্ত কাতারে প্রতিটিতে প্রায় সাড়ে ৪ মিলিয়ন বার্তা রয়েছে। খুব সহজেই আমরা খুব কম সংখ্যক বার্তা কাতারে রাখি কারণ আমরা খুব দ্রুত ডেটা প্রক্রিয়া করি। কিছু ঘটেছিল (কী তা নিশ্চিত নয়) এবং এটি সমস্ত জাহান্নামে চলে গেছে।
mrdenny

জন, আমার জন্য উঁকি দেওয়ার জন্য ধন্যবাদ। টিএমকিউ থেকে প্রাপ্ত ফলাফলের ভিত্তিতে আমি অনুমান করছি যে এটি আমার সমস্যা। পুলের সীমাবদ্ধতা (কেবিতে আনুমানিক গণনা করা) পৃষ্ঠাযুক্ত: সীমা 307,200 397% জন্য ব্যবহৃত ননপ্যাজড: সীমা 262,144 49% এর জন্য ব্যবহৃত হয়েছে আমি পিএসএস আমাকে ফিরে ডাকার অপেক্ষায় থাকাকালীন স্রোত ধীরে ধীরে সারি পেয়েছি। এমভিপি শীর্ষ সম্মেলনের সময় আপনি যদি রেডমন্ডে থাকেন তবে আমাকে জানান, আমার উপর বিয়ার করুন।
mrdenny

@ ব্যবহারকারী34024 আমরা প্রাথমিক সমস্যাটি পেয়েছি, যা আমি উপরে একটি মন্তব্য রেখেছি। সাহায্যের জন্য ধন্যবাদ.
mrdenny

1

আমি আমাদের একটি সিস্টেমেডমিনকে জিজ্ঞাসা করেছি এবং তিনি বলেছিলেন যে আমাদের ম্যাজিক পয়েন্টটি ছিল 4 ওয়েব সার্ভার সর্বাধিক ভার্চুয়াল মেশিনে এমএসএমকিউ বক্স হিট করা, তারপরে তারা সমাধানের জন্য হার্ডওয়্যার বক্সে চলে এসেছিল। কী চলছে তা দেখতে প্যাকেট ক্যাপচার চেষ্টা করুন। প্রমাণীকরণের অনেক কি AD তে যাচ্ছে? চ্যাটি এমএসএমকিউ কেমন তা আপনাকে নেটওয়ার্ক পাথ এবং সম্ভবত প্রমাণীকরণের পথ সীমাবদ্ধ করতে হবে।

এইচটিএইচ, চক


আপনি যখন একক এমএসএমকিউ সার্ভারের সাথে 4 টিরও বেশি ওয়েব সার্ভারের সাথে কথা বলছেন তখন কী তারা ঠিক পিছনে পেরেছিল? স্টোরেজটি আইএসসিএসআই-এর উপরে সরাসরি এসএএন স্টোরেজ হয় তাই এটি প্রতি মন্তব্য হিসাবে স্টোরেজ সমস্যা হওয়া উচিত নয়। আমি 8 টি ওয়েব সার্ভারের মধ্যে 4 টি পাওয়ার করার চেষ্টা করব এবং আমি কী সামনে এসেছি তা দেখতে পাবো। আমি যদি আমার বসকে নতুন হার্ডওয়্যার কিনতে বলি, তবে খুব খারাপ কারণ দরকার।
mrdenny

কেবল বার্তাগুলির আড্ডাবাজি। তারা কিছু প্রমাণীকরণ মিস কনফিগারেশনও পেয়েছে।
এসকিউএলগুইচাক

আমার ধারণা আমি ওয়্যারশার্ক ডাউনলোড করব এবং এটি এমএসএমকিউ সার্ভারে রেখে দেব এবং এটি কী দেখায় তা দেখতে পাবো। এটি ওয়েব সার্ভারে রাখতে পারি না, এটি নেটওয়ার্ক ট্র্যাফিক লোডের কারণে প্রায় 30 সেকেন্ড পরে ক্র্যাশ হয়ে যায়।
mrdenny

তাই আমি মেশিনে ওয়্যারশার্ককে বহিস্কার করেছি এবং আমি যে ওয়েব সার্ভারটি পর্যবেক্ষণ করছি তার বার্তাগুলির মধ্যে প্রায় 3 সেকেন্ড দেখছি seeing বলা বাহুল্য, এটি দেখতে ভাল লাগছে না।
mrdenny

আমরা প্রাথমিক সমস্যাটি পেয়েছি, যা আমি উপরে একটি মন্তব্যে রেখেছি। সাহায্যের জন্য ধন্যবাদ.
mrdenny

1

রিমোট প্রশাসনের অভাব সম্পর্কে আপনার মন্তব্য উল্লেখ করে, হ্যাঁ, এটি এমএসএমকিউ এবং পারফেক্ট কাউন্টারগুলির সাথে দুর্দান্ত গল্প নয়। থ্রেড অনুসরণ করে ও ওএসের সংমিশ্রণগুলি কী কাজ করে তা জানতে আগ্রহী সবার জন্য মোটল কুই ব্লগটি একবার দেখুন:

MSMQ 4.0 পারফরমেন্স কাউন্টারে এবং NetNameForPerfCounters রেজিস্ট্রি কী http://blogs.msdn.com/motleyqueue/archive/2007/12/14/msmq-4-0-performance-counters-and-the-netnameforperfcounters-registry-key.aspx

চিয়ার্স জন ব্রেকওয়েল (এমএসএফটি)

আ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.